MOBY will launch a new digital music format when he releases his new single ’LIFT ME UP’ on Monday (February 28)

The format, called di, will allow the listener to edit and personalise tracks using alternative, original material recorded by the artist that is also included with the single.

Users will then be able to resave their mixes as MP3 files.

Moby said: "Anyone who loves music can see the benefits of the di format. It's simple, interactive and rewarding. I had so many things that I wanted to do with ’Lift Me Up’ and now with di fans can see some of the other things I had in mind, and can come up with their own mixes as well.”
